Transaction 66499d58496990e88433f97d0589a9543fb56d014f964f39a4188830dffb81fa
1 Input
1 Output
-
66499d58496990e88433f97d0589a9543fb56d014f964f39a4188830dffb81fa:0
- value
- 582644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c5fb742cd9dc0c7d94c9a97df0105bf5e2c7568 OP_EQUAL
- address
- 3QhSsLfGEqHbZwEqn8bycA5TEZcEfBHzVz